How to Detect Moisture Under Flooring? A Definitive Guide
Detecting moisture under your flooring requires a keen eye, diligent investigation, and sometimes specialized tools. Early identification is crucial to prevent costly structural damage, mold growth, and unhealthy living conditions. Visual Clues to Look For
One of the first steps is a careful visual inspection. Look for these telltale signs:
- Discoloration: Water damage often leaves noticeable stains on flooring materials. Look for dark patches, rings, or general fading, especially near walls, pipes, and appliances.
- Warping or Buckling: Moisture causes wood and laminate floors to swell and distort. Warping, cupping (where the edges of boards are higher than the center), and buckling are clear indicators of water absorption.
- Peeling or Blistering: Vinyl or linoleum flooring may exhibit peeling or blistering where moisture is trapped underneath.
- Grout Discoloration or Cracking: In tiled areas, discolored or crumbling grout can indicate water seeping through the surface.
- Efflorescence: This white, powdery deposit on tile or concrete is caused by mineral salts carried to the surface by moisture and left behind as the water evaporates.
The Power of Smell: Detecting Hidden Moisture
Your sense of smell can be a powerful tool in detecting moisture. A musty or moldy odor is a strong indication of underlying moisture problems. This smell often emanates from mold growth, which thrives in damp, dark environments. Don’t dismiss even a faint odor; investigate further to pinpoint the source.
Employing Moisture Detection Tools
For a more definitive assessment, consider using these tools:
- Moisture Meter: This device measures the moisture content of materials. There are two primary types:
- Pin Meters: These meters use probes to penetrate the flooring and measure electrical resistance, which correlates with moisture content. They are effective for solid wood but may damage some flooring types.
- Pinless Meters: These meters use electromagnetic sensors to detect moisture without penetrating the surface. They are ideal for delicate flooring and provide a broader reading.
- Infrared Thermometer: While not specifically designed for moisture detection, an infrared thermometer can identify areas of temperature difference. Cold spots on a floor may indicate the presence of moisture due to evaporative cooling.
- Hygrometer: This instrument measures the relative humidity in the air. High humidity levels can contribute to moisture problems, even if there are no visible signs of water damage.
Proactive Prevention: Minimizing Moisture Risks
While detecting moisture is crucial, preventing it in the first place is even more important. Take these proactive steps:
- Proper Ventilation: Ensure adequate ventilation in bathrooms, kitchens, and basements to reduce humidity levels. Use exhaust fans when showering or cooking.
- Regular Inspections: Periodically inspect plumbing fixtures, appliances, and the foundation for leaks. Address any issues promptly.
- Effective Waterproofing: Apply appropriate waterproofing measures in bathrooms, laundry rooms, and other areas prone to water exposure. Seal grout lines regularly.
- Controlling Humidity: Use dehumidifiers in damp basements or crawl spaces to maintain optimal humidity levels.

FAQ 1: What is the most common cause of moisture under flooring?
The most common causes are leaks from plumbing fixtures (toilets, sinks, pipes), spills that are not cleaned up promptly, condensation due to poor ventilation, and rising damp from the ground, especially in basements and crawl spaces.
FAQ 2: Can I detect moisture under tile flooring?
Yes, but it can be more challenging. Look for discolored grout, efflorescence, cracked tiles, and a hollow sound when tapping on tiles. Use a moisture meter designed for tile or concrete.
FAQ 3: Is mold always present with moisture under flooring?
Not always, but it’s highly likely if the moisture persists for an extended period. Mold requires moisture, a food source (like wood or drywall), and a suitable temperature to grow. Prolonged moisture creates the perfect environment for mold development.
FAQ 4: How do I check for moisture under carpet?
Visually inspect for stains, discoloration, and a musty odor. Press down on the carpet in various areas; if it feels damp or spongy, moisture is likely present. A moisture meter with a deep-penetrating probe can also be used.
FAQ 5: What should I do if I find moisture under my flooring?
First, identify and stop the source of the moisture. Then, remove any affected flooring materials to allow the subfloor to dry thoroughly. Consider using dehumidifiers and fans to speed up the drying process. If mold is present, consult a professional mold remediation service.
FAQ 6: Can I repair moisture damage myself, or should I hire a professional?
For minor leaks and superficial damage, you may be able to handle the repairs yourself. However, significant water damage, mold growth, or structural issues require professional assistance. A qualified contractor can properly assess the damage, make necessary repairs, and prevent future problems.
FAQ 7: What are the long-term consequences of ignoring moisture under flooring?
Ignoring moisture can lead to structural damage (rotting wood, weakened supports), mold growth (health problems, unpleasant odors), pest infestations (termites, carpenter ants), and decreased property value. Addressing moisture problems promptly is crucial to protecting your investment and your health.
FAQ 8: Does my homeowner’s insurance cover moisture damage?
It depends on the cause of the moisture. Most policies cover sudden and accidental water damage, such as a burst pipe. However, they typically exclude damage caused by gradual leaks, neglected maintenance, or flooding. Check your policy carefully and consult with your insurance provider.
FAQ 9: How can I prevent rising damp in my basement?
Ensure proper drainage around your foundation, seal any cracks in the foundation walls, install a vapor barrier under the slab, and consider using a dehumidifier to maintain low humidity levels. A professional waterproofing system may be necessary in severe cases.
FAQ 10: Are some types of flooring more susceptible to moisture damage than others?
Yes. Natural wood flooring is highly susceptible to warping and rotting when exposed to moisture. Laminate flooring can also be damaged by moisture. Tile and vinyl flooring are more water-resistant but can still suffer damage if moisture seeps underneath.
FAQ 11: How accurate are DIY moisture detection methods compared to professional inspections?
DIY methods can provide an initial indication of moisture, but professional inspections are more thorough and accurate. Professionals have specialized equipment and expertise to identify hidden sources of moisture and assess the extent of the damage.
FAQ 12: What are the costs associated with repairing moisture damage under flooring?
The cost varies widely depending on the extent of the damage, the type of flooring, and the required repairs. Minor repairs may cost a few hundred dollars, while extensive damage requiring structural repairs and mold remediation can cost thousands. Obtain multiple quotes from qualified contractors before proceeding with any repairs.
